Where things start to go wrong, is with the advent of the Digital Brickwall Limiter, which is capable of looking ahead to pull down peak levels before they happen. This in itself isn’t so much of an issue. Once they became the primary consumable medium in the 90’s, louder, hotter masters began to take advantage of the increased dynamic range with peak levels often hovering around the 0 dB limit and record companies pushing up levels to remain competitive. With the introduction of CD’s, the maximum peak level was no longer limited by the analogue equipment, but was instead encoded digitally with a clearly defined maximum peak amplitude. For this reason, the race for ever louder records never reached extremes during this era. Back then, however, the physical limitations of vinyl would naturally limit to how loud you could press a record before it would disturb the needle and render the medium un-playable. The jukebox would normally be set to a pre defined volume by the owner, and thus if your records were mastered “hotter” than the others, it would be louder, and subsequently gain more attention – in theory. The loudness war is a phenomenon dating back to the release of 7″ singles played on jukeboxes in pubs, clubs, & bars. The aim of any risk evaluation tool is to ensure that the decision process is transparent, based on best knowledge and reflecting the common understanding of stakeholders. Using a risk matrix is both a qualitative and quantitative approach to prioritize risk and start interventions to mitigate the risk and to facilitate constructive discussions within a decision process. Nonetheless, given the paradigm, it may be that professionals, policymakers or even patients may decide differently on the same questions raised.Ī risk matrix can be helpful and insightful to agree upon new or changed interventions as they present complex risk data in a concise visual and mathematical way. When deciding upon new interventions or strategies, these novel actions should at least prevent or lower the risk of an adverse event to occur. In any case, an intervention is expected to change risk. A newly introduced intervention may decrease the probability of an event to happen and/or can have an effect on its impact. Some interventions have a diagnostic character, whereas others have a preventive or therapeutic effect. In healthcare, prior to introducing a new intervention or diagnostic threshold, professionals and policy makers have to consider what level of risk they would accept and what the expected effect of a newly introduced intervention is. Nonetheless, risk is an objective existence which can never be eliminated, is abrupt and often harmful with people suffering loss, may be uncertain in whether and when the event will happen, and is constantly developing with science and technology. Therefore, decisions are affected by estimating chances and taking the characteristics of these taken chances into account. The impact of that event can be either beneficial or detrimental, ranging from minor to major. However, risk is generally described as the combination of the linked likelihood of occurrence times the impact of a certain event.
